    Patients' and clinicians' preferences in adjuvant treatment for high-risk endometrial cancer:Implications for shared decision making

    Get PDF
    Background. Decision making regarding adjuvant therapy for high-risk endometrial cancer is complex. The aim of this study was to determine patients' and clinicians' minimally desired survival benefit to choose chemoradiotherapy over radiotherapy alone. Moreover, influencing factors and importance of positive and negative treatment effects (i.e. attribute) were investigated. Methods. Patients with high-risk endometrial cancer treated with adjuvant pelvic radiotherapy with or without chemotherapy and multidisciplinary gynaecologic oncology clinicians completed a trade-off questionnaire based on PORTEC-3 trial data. Results. In total, 171 patients and 63 clinicians completed the questionnaire. Median minimally desired benefit to make chemoradiotherapy worthwhile was significantly higher for patients versus clinicians (10% vs 5%, p = 0.02). Both patients and clinicians rated survival benefit most important during decision making, followed by long-term symptoms. Older patients (OR 0.92 [95%CI 0.87 & ndash;0.97]; p = 0.003) with comorbidity (OR 0.34 [95% CI 0.12 & ndash;0.89]; p = 0.035) had lower preference for chemoradiotherapy, while patients with better numeracy skills (OR 1.2 [95%CI 1.05 & ndash;1.36], p = 0.011) and chemoradiotherapy history (OR 25.0 [95%CI 8.8 & ndash;91.7]; p < 0.001) had higher preference for chemoradiotherapy. & nbsp;Conclusions. There is a considerable difference in minimally desired survival benefit of chemoradiotherapy in high-risk endometrial cancer among and between patients and clinicians. Overall, endometrial cancer patients needed higher benefits than clinicians before preferring chemoradiotherapy. (c) 2021 The Authors. Published by Elsevier Inc.     Pulmonary cachexia, systemic inflammatory profile, and the interleukin 1ß -511 single nucleotide polymorphism

    No full text
    Background: Cachexia is common in chronic obstructive pulmonary disease (COPD) and is thought to be linked to an enhanced systemic inflammatory response. Objective: We investigated differences in the systemic inflammatory profile and polymorphisms in related inflammatory genes in COPD patients. Design: A cross-sectional study was performed in 99 patients with COPD (Global Initiative for Chronic Obstructive Lung Disease stages II–IV), who were stratified by cachexia based on fat-free mass index (FFMI; in kg/m2: &lt;16 for men and &lt;15 for women) and compared with healthy control subjects (HCs). Body composition was determined by bioelectrical impedance analysis. Plasma concentrations and gene polymorphisms of interleukin 1ß (IL-1ß –511), IL-6 (IL-6 –174), and the tumor necrosis factor system (TNF- –308 and lymphotoxin- +252) were determined. Plasma C-reactive protein, leptin, and urinary pseudouridine (as a marker of cellular protein breakdown) were measured. Results: Fat mass, leptin, and pseudouridine were significantly different (P &lt; 0.001) between noncachectic patients (NCPs) and cachectic patients (CPs: n = 35); the systemic inflammatory cytokine profile was not. NCPs had a body compositional shift toward a lower fat-free mass and a higher fat mass compared with HCs. CPs and NCPs had a greater systemic inflammatory response (P &lt; 0.05) than did HCs, as reflected in C-reactive protein, soluble TNF-R75, and IL-6 concentrations. The overall distribution of the IL-1ß –511 polymorphism was significantly different between the groups (P &lt; 0.05). Conclusions: In COPD patients, who are characterized by an elevated systemic inflammatory response, cachexia is not discriminatory for the extent of increase in inflammatory status. This study, however, indicates a potential influence of genetic predisposition on the cachexia process. <br/
